Note


IMPORTANT: M16C/1N Microcomputer Flash Memory Version.This algorithm is written in Parallel I/O mode. In the Data Pattern4K-byte Boot ROM is mapped to 0000h-0FFFh;4K-byte Data ROM (block B and A) is mapped to F000h-FFFFh;64K-byte User ROM is divided into several blocks and they are mapped toFF000h-FFFFFh.Data Pattern locations FFE00h-FFFFFh are specialprogramming incorrect data would cause the part to stop communication.The Boot ROM area of the device has a standard serial I/O modecontrol program stored in it when shipped from the factory.Therefore if the device is going to be used in standard serial I/O modedo not rewrite the Boot ROM area.Device Configure Options allow the individual Memory sections to be selectedfor device operations. Before executingany command at least 1 Operations Area must be selected.
